I always thought he was the coolest member of Pulp (admittedly not a difficult task), but I had no idea of his post Pulp music biz’ activities. Reading his obit’ in The Guardian this morning it turns out he was behind Florence + The Machine. Writing songs and producing some stuff on her debut album. He was also involved with Daft Punk, The Horrors, Arcade Fire, MIA, amongst others.
He told Pulp that he wasn’t interested in rejoining for this summer’s reunion as he was now a successful photographer, working with Miu Miu, Armani, Moncler Saint Laurent and Gucci.
